In This Novel, a Black South African Becomes a Domestic Worker — in Her Son’s Home - The New York Times IF YOU WANT TO MAKE GOD LAUGH Like family. “It’s good to see the rainbow nation is alive and well,” one character says upon returning to her native Johannesburg in the immediate wake of apartheid. “And that we aren’t the only unusual South African family.” These lines, spoken as the multiracial cast attends a hearing of the Truth and Reconciliation Commission, capture the liberal piety that drags down the book’s attempt at “non-racial” sisterhood. The “family” in question includes Delilah and Ruth, well-to-do adult white sisters, and their black teenage domestic worker, Zodwa, all of whom struggle with issues of motherhood over the course of the congested, overplotted narrative. The novel begins in late 1993, in the months leading up to South Africa’s first democratic elections.
